

Mary Ann Penman, 79, of Peoria, IL passed away Thursday July 10, 2014 at OSF St. Francis Medical Center. Mary was born in St. Louis, MO on January 13, 1935 to Elmer and Gertrude (Krawiecki) Robinson. She married William Penman on September 18, 1955. He preceded her in death in November, 1995. She is survived by: Children; Glenn Penman of Peoria, IL and Julie (Don) Neckel of Peoria, IL, Sister; Alberta Sue Van Norman of Windsor, NC, Granddaughters; Jessica and Melissa Neckel of Peoria, IL, Lifelong friend; Jenny Casey of Marquette Heights, IL and several nieces and nephews. Mary is preceded in death by her Husband, Parents, Sister; Emily Ready, and brother; John Kargol. Mary worked for the Home Insurance Company for over 10 years. She loved to paint China Dishes and lamps, and was a member of the China Painters Guild. She enjoyed collecting Figurine Dolls, looking for unique antiques at garage sales and flea markets, and also planting flowers outside of her home. Funeral services for Mary will be held at Davison-Fulton Woodland Chapel on Tuesday July 15, 2014 at 11:00 AM. Pastor Karin Spaulding will officiate. Visitation will be held two hours prior to the service. Burial will be in Swan Lake Memory Gardens.
